Output 87f59f8f663ecf6fbfb7829ff78ae4d39751388e7f2400e61e071d8eb2d8e02d:4

value
19728941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03edad97d93a1297215d789cecfc8404815e1767 OP_EQUAL
address
M8FvzAnKNC8RB7BBHy6mY8USnotZ5ftpJw
transaction
87f59f8f663ecf6fbfb7829ff78ae4d39751388e7f2400e61e071d8eb2d8e02d
spent
true